File tree Expand file tree Collapse file tree 1 file changed +4
-4
lines changed
swift/ql/src/queries/Security/CWE-135 Expand file tree Collapse file tree 1 file changed +4
-4
lines changed Original file line number Diff line number Diff line change @@ -56,10 +56,10 @@ class StringLengthConflationConfiguration extends DataFlow::Configuration {
56
56
StringLengthConflationConfiguration ( ) { this = "StringLengthConflationConfiguration" }
57
57
58
58
override predicate isSource ( DataFlow:: Node node , string flowstate ) {
59
- exists ( MemberRefExpr member , string className , string varName |
60
- member .getBase ( ) .getType ( ) .( NominalType ) .getABaseType * ( ) .getName ( ) = className and
61
- member .getMember ( ) .( VarDecl ) .getName ( ) = varName and
62
- node .asExpr ( ) = member and
59
+ exists ( MemberRefExpr memberRef , string className , string varName |
60
+ memberRef .getBase ( ) .getType ( ) .( NominalType ) .getABaseType * ( ) .getName ( ) = className and
61
+ memberRef .getMember ( ) .( VarDecl ) .getName ( ) = varName and
62
+ node .asExpr ( ) = memberRef and
63
63
(
64
64
// result of a call to `String.count`
65
65
className = "String" and
You can’t perform that action at this time.
0 commit comments